Dunbrody Cucumber Pickle with Rocket
This cucumber pickle can be used in so many different ways. If it is stored in sterilized jars it will last for up to two months. I find it a useful staple to keep in the fridge as it is delicious on its own as an appetiser, with pan-fried fish or on a smoked salmon platter…I could go on and on. It is also great for using up the glut of cucumbers that the summer always seems to bring.
Ingredients
- serves: 4-6
- time: N/A
- oven temp: N/A°C / N/A°F
- 1 cucumber
- 1 onion, thinly sliced
- 2 red chillies, seeded and cut into very fine julienne (slices)
- 500 ml/18 fl oz rice wine vinegar
- 300 g/11 oz light muscovado sugar
- 2 tsp coriander seeds
- good pinch saffron stands
- 1 tsp Maldon sea salt
- 100 g/4 oz rocket
- olive oil, for dressing
Dunbrody Cucumber Pickle with Rocket
Cut the cucumber in half lengthways and using a teaspoon, remove the seeds. Using a vegetable peeler, pare the flesh into wafer-thin ribbons and place in a pan. Add the onion, chillies, rice wine vinegar, sugar, coriander seeds, saffron and salt. Slowly bring to the boil, then reduce the heat and simmer for 20 minutes until the vegetables are completely tender and the liquid has reduced and thickened slightly.
If you are not planning on using the cucumber pickle immediately, wash a Kilner jar or a couple of jam jars, rinse thoroughly, then dry in a warm oven. Stand them upside down on a clean tea towel.
If you are using jam jars, fill them, then cover with a disc of waxed paper while still hot or else completely cold, then seal with a dampened disc of clear plastic, secure with an elastic band and screw back on their tops. Simply secure and close a Kilner jar in the normal way. Label and store in a cool, dark place for up to two months, then use as required. Otherwise transfer the cucumber pickle to a bowl, cover with cling film and chill until needed.
To Serve
Drain the excess liquid from the cucumber pickle and fold in the rocket leaves, then lightly dress with olive oil. Arrange on serving plates.
